Flattening device for transformer coil copper wire
By designing a combination of upper and lower pressing rollers and a guide device, the shape transformation and guidance problems during winding of the transformer coil copper wire are solved, the copper wire is effectively flattened, the contact area and mechanical strength are improved, and the production requirements of the transformer coil are met.

In the existing technology, it is difficult to change the copper wire of the transformer coil from a round shape to a flat shape during winding, and there is a lack of effective guiding and extrusion devices, resulting in a small contact area and large gaps, which cannot meet the requirements of mechanical strength and winding convenience.
A flattening device including an upper pressing roller, a lower pressing roller, a transmission device and a guide device is designed. The copper wire is driven by the transmission device to pass between the upper and lower pressing rollers. The copper wire is flattened by utilizing the adjustable height of the lower pressing roller and the guidance of the guide hook. The guidance and extrusion effect of the copper wire are ensured by the cooperation of the guide frame and the spring.
It achieves effective flattening of the copper wire, increases the contact area, reduces the gap, improves the mechanical strength and the convenience of winding, and meets the production requirements of transformer coils.

[0001] The utility model relates to the field of coils, in particular to the technical field of transformer copper wire winding, and specifically refers to a flattening device for transformer coil copper wires. Background Art
[0002] Transformer coils are generally classified into two types: layer and pancake. Layer coils are those where the turns are arranged in layers along the axial direction and wound continuously. Each layer is cylindrical, ensuring good mechanical strength, resistance to deformation, and ease of winding. Coils consisting of two layers are called double-layer cylindrical coils; coils consisting of multiple layers are called multi-layer cylindrical coils.
[0003] The transformer coil includes an iron core, and copper plates and copper wires wound on the iron core. When the copper wire is wound, it needs to be flattened so that the cross-section of the copper wire changes from a circle to a flat shape with the top and bottom surfaces being flat and the two side surfaces being arc-shaped. The contact area between the copper wires of this shape is large and the gap is small. In order to meet the above requirements, the copper wire needs to be flattened once. At the same time, since the coil is transferred from above the coil extrusion point to the coil extrusion point, a guide device is also required on the feeding side. Utility Model Content
[0004] In view of the deficiencies in the prior art, the utility model provides a flattening device for transformer coil copper wires, which performs extrusion before winding the copper wires, thereby meeting production requirements.
[0005] The utility model is realized through the following technical scheme: a flattening device for transformer coil copper wire, comprising a box body, an upper pressing roller and a lower pressing roller arranged on the box body and squeezing the copper wire, and a transmission device for driving the copper wire to be transported, wherein the lower pressing roller is connected to a lower base sliding along the height direction, the bottom surface of the lower base is a first inclined surface, the box body is provided with a slider sliding along the inclined direction of the first inclined surface and supporting the lower base, a guide frame is further provided at the rear of the upper pressing roller, the guide frame is hinged with a guide hook located behind the upper pressing roller, a spring is fixed to the guide frame for driving the guide hook to rotate downward, the end surface of the guide hook in contact with the copper wire is a third inclined surface, and the third inclined surface is inclined downward from back to front.
[0006] When the utility model is in use, the copper wire is driven by the transmission device to pass through between the upper pressing roller and the lower pressing roller, and the upper pressing roller and the lower pressing roller squeeze the top surface and the bottom surface of the copper wire, thereby flattening the copper wire. At the same time, by adjusting the sliding position of the slider, the position of the slider supporting the first inclined surface is adjusted, thereby adjusting the height of the lower base on the box body, thereby adjusting the height of the lower pressing roller, and by adjusting the distance between the upper pressing roller and the lower pressing roller, the squeezing strength of the copper wire is adjusted; by setting the spring and the guide hook, the copper wire is pressed downward, thereby guiding the copper wire, and the setting of the third inclined surface also plays a guiding role.
[0007] Preferably, the top surface of the slider is a second inclined surface adapted to the first inclined surface.
[0008] In this preferred solution, the second inclined surface plays a guiding role, making it easy to adjust the height of the lower base by sliding the slider.
[0009] Preferably, the slider is threadedly connected to a lead screw extending along the sliding direction of the slider and axially connected to the box body, and a turning handle is fixed to the lead screw.
[0010] This preferred solution facilitates driving the slider to slide by arranging the lead screw and the turning handle.
[0011] Preferably, the transmission device is located in front of the upper pressure roller, and the transmission device includes a plurality of transmission discs and a motor for driving the transmission discs to rotate. The circumferential surface of the transmission disc is provided with a plurality of annular grooves for the copper wire to pass around.
[0012] In this preferred solution, when in use, the copper wire is wound in the ring groove, and the transmission disc is driven to rotate by the motor, thereby driving the copper wire to be transmitted.
[0013] Preferably, the cross section of the annular groove is tapered. In this preferred solution, when the copper wire is located in the annular groove, the two inclined side surfaces of the annular groove squeeze the copper wire, thereby increasing the friction between the copper wire and the transmission disc and preventing the copper wire from slipping on the transmission disc.
[0014] Preferably, the number of the annular grooves is twice the number of the copper wires. This preferred solution can achieve simultaneous transmission and extrusion of two copper wires by setting the number of annular grooves, and can also achieve two windings of the copper wires on the transmission disk, thereby increasing the friction between the copper wires and the transmission disk and preventing the copper wires from slipping on the transmission disk.
[0015] Preferably, the guide frame is provided with two guide rollers located on both sides of the copper wire and between the guide hook and the upper pressure roller, and the guide rollers extend in the height direction.
[0016] Preferably, the box body is further provided with two guide groups located on both sides of the copper wire extrusion, and the two guide groups are arranged along the copper wire transmission direction. The guide groups include two guide plates located at the upper and lower ends of the copper wire. The box body is also provided with a guide block, and the guide block is provided with a guide hole for the copper wire to pass through. The guide plate is located between the copper wire extrusion point and the guide block.
[0017] This preferred solution restricts the copper wire from bending upward or downward by providing two guide groups, and at the same time provides the copper wire with a guiding effect by providing guide holes.

[0032] Refer to the attached Figure 1-10 The utility model is a flattening device for transformer coil copper wire, comprising a box body 8, an upper pressing roller 1 is connected to the upper axis of the box body 8, a lower pressing roller 2 is provided directly below the upper pressing roller 1, and the copper wire passes between the upper pressing roller 1 and the lower pressing roller 2. The upper pressing roller 1 and the lower pressing roller 2 squeeze the copper wire to meet production needs.
[0033] The lower pressure roller 2 is axially connected to the lower base 4 that slides along the height direction. The box body 8 is provided with two limit blocks located in front and rear of the lower base 4. The bottom surface of the lower base 4 is a first inclined surface 15. The first inclined surface 15 extends obliquely along the axial direction of the upper pressure roller 1. The box body 8 is provided with a slider 3 that slides along the inclined direction of the first inclined surface 15 and supports the lower base 4. The top surface of the slider 3 is a second inclined surface that is adapted to the first inclined surface 15. The slider 3 is threadedly connected to a screw 5 that extends along the sliding direction of the slider 3 and is axially connected to the box body 8. A turning handle 6 is fixed to the screw 5, and the turning handle 6 can also be replaced with a motor.
[0034] The box body 8 is also provided with two guide groups 14 located on both sides of the copper wire extrusion, and the two guide groups 14 are arranged along the copper wire transmission direction. The guide groups 14 include two guide plates located at the upper and lower ends of the copper wire. The box body 8 is also provided with a guide block 13, and the guide block 13 is provided with a guide hole for the copper wire to pass through. The guide plate is located between the copper wire extrusion point and the guide block 13.
[0035] The box body 8 is also provided with a transmission device for conveying copper wire. The transmission device is located in front of the upper pressure roller 1 and the lower pressure roller 2. The transmission device includes three transmission disks and three motors that respectively drive the three transmission disks to rotate. A plurality of annular grooves 17 for the copper wire to pass around are provided on the circumferential surface of the transmission disk. The cross-section of the annular groove 17 is conical. Four annular grooves 17 are provided on the same transmission disk, which can meet the simultaneous transmission of two copper wires and can also realize two windings of two copper wires on the same transmission disk.
[0036] The top surface of the first transmission disk is flush with the copper wire extrusion point. The second transmission disk is located directly above the first transmission disk, and the third transmission disk is located in front of the second transmission disk. The copper wire is transmitted forward and downward, and bypasses the first transmission disk from back to front, then moves upward and bypasses the second transmission disk from back to front, then is transmitted downward and bypasses the third transmission disk from back to front, then is transmitted backward and upward, bypasses the second transmission disk again from back to front, then is transmitted downward and bypasses the third transmission disk from back to front, and then is transmitted forward.
[0037] A guide frame 9 connected to the box body 8 is further provided at the rear of the upper pressing roller 1 . The guide frame 9 is provided with two guide rollers located on both sides of the copper wire, and the guide rollers extend in the height direction.
[0038] The guide frame 9 is hingedly connected to a guide hook 11 located above and behind the wire roller 10 through a hinge shaft. A spring 12 is fixed to the guide frame 9 to drive the guide hook 11 to rotate downward. The end face of the guide hook 11 in contact with the copper wire is a third inclined surface 16. The third inclined surface 16 is inclined downward from back to front. The third inclined surface 16 and the spring 12 are located on both sides of the hinge shaft.
[0039] In particular, see the attached Figure 2 , the copper wire is transmitted from back to front, the left side is the front and the right side is the back.
[0040] When the utility model is in use, the copper wire is driven by the transmission device to pass through between the upper pressing roller 1 and the lower pressing roller 2. The upper pressing roller 1 and the lower pressing roller 2 squeeze the top and bottom surfaces of the copper wire, thereby flattening the copper wire. At the same time, by adjusting the sliding position of the slider 3, the position of the first inclined surface 15 supported by the slider 3 is adjusted, thereby adjusting the height of the lower base 4 on the box body 8, thereby adjusting the height of the lower pressing roller 2, and adjusting the distance between the upper pressing roller 1 and the lower pressing roller 2, thereby adjusting the squeezing strength of the copper wire; the setting of the second inclined surface plays a guiding role, making it convenient to adjust the height of the lower base 4 by sliding the slider 3.
